从表行检索数据
适用于:Outlook 2013 | Outlook 2016
从表中检索行涉及:
获取所有列的属性值。
修改当前位置。
大多数表中的必需列之一是条目标识符( PR_ENTRYID (PidTagEntryId) 属性),可用于打开表示行的对象。 此条目标识符通常是短期条目标识符,不会在表的生存期内保留。 但是,如果实现表的服务提供商仅支持一种类型的条目标识符,则它可以是长期标识符。
客户端和服务提供商可以进行以下调用之一来检索行:
呼叫 | 说明 |
---|---|
IMAPITable::QueryRows |
在向前或向后方向检索从当前行开始的指定行数。 |
HrQueryAllRows |
检索表中的所有行。 |
ITableData::HrQueryRow |
根据其索引列的值检索表中的行。 PR_INSTANCE_KEY (PidTagInstanceKey) 通常是表的索引列。 |
当可选属性作为表中的列之一包含时,某些行可能具有列的有效值,而其他行可能没有。 列是否存在有效值取决于提供行信息的对象是否设置 属性。 根据 对象的实现,不存在的属性可以在表中表示为 PR_NULL (PidTagNull) 或任意值。 表的用户必须小心区分不存在且具有无意义值的属性和确实存在且具有有效值的属性。